Book Overview

Initial Problems In The Philosophy Of Life is a book written by an unknown author and published by William Hunt And Company in 1864. The book is a philosophical treatise that explores the fundamental questions of life, including the nature of existence, the purpose of human life, and the relationship between the individual and society.The book begins by examining the concept of life itself, exploring its various meanings and implications. From there, the author delves into the nature of consciousness, exploring the relationship between the mind and the body and the role of perception in shaping our understanding of the world.The book also explores the role of ethics in human life, examining the nature of morality and the relationship between individual values and societal norms. The author considers the question of free will and determinism, exploring the extent to which human beings are capable of shaping their own destinies.Throughout the book, the author draws on a wide range of philosophical traditions, including ancient Greek philosophy, Enlightenment thought, and contemporary existentialism. The result is a thought-provoking and challenging exploration of some of the most fundamental questions of human existence.Overall, Initial Problems In The Philosophy Of Life is a valuable resource for anyone interested in philosophy or seeking to deepen their understanding of the nature of human existence.This scarce antiquarian book is a facsimile reprint of the old original and may contain some imperfections such as library marks and notations.
